Is C++ harder than Python?

Is C++ Harder Than Python? Yes, C++ is harder to learn and work with than Python. The biggest difference is that C++ has a more complex syntax to work with and involves more memory management than Python, which is both simple to learn and use. Python is considered a better beginner programming language.10 Jan 2022

Which is the hardest coding language?

Answers: Actually, both are difficult and both are easy. C++ is built upon C and thus supports all features of C and also, it has object-oriented programming features. When it comes to learning, size-wise C is smaller with few concepts to learn while C++ is vast. Hence we can say C is easier than C++.16 Jul 2022
